Title: Necessary and sufficient conditions for calculus of variations under interval uncertainty

Authors: Mohammad Heidari; Mohadeseh Ramezanzadeh

Addresses: Young Researchers and Elite Club, Ayatollah Amoli Branch, Islamic Azad University, Amol, Iran ' School of Mathematics and Computer Science, Damghan University, Damghan, Iran

Abstract: In this paper, a complete investigation of necessary and sufficient conditions is discussed on the variational problems under interval uncertainty. More precisely, it is shown that based on the parametric representation of an interval, the interval variational problems can be interpreted as a set of classical variational problems. Finally, to show the ability and significance of this point of view on the necessary and sufficient conditions, two comprehensive examples are proposed, more specifically the Hanging Cable Problem.

Keywords: interval-valued function; parametric representation; calculus of variations; Euler-Lagrange equation; sufficient condition.
